P K M TRINITY GALLERY is pleased to present an exhibition of new works by the internationally acclaimed artist Olafur Eliasson. "Is the sky part of a landscape," his second solo exhibition in Korea after his first show with P K M GALLERY in 2007, features works in a wide range of scale and media, including paintings, photographs, sculptures, and large installations.
In his new works, he continues the strategy of employing basic elements appropriated from nature. Eliasson's portrayal of nature may seem in some ways to take after the Romantic tradition, which holds nature as an object of aesthetic contemplation and awe. Encountering his works, however, viewers are completely overtaken by sensory effects produced by processes and mechanisms that are laid bare. And in this manner, Eliasson's work departs from an idealized conception of nature and leads viewers to locate themselves within the present, to become conscious of the interconnection between individuals and their surroundings. In their journey through the exhibition, undergoing diverse sensory experiences that have been precisely calibrated by the artist, viewers will find themselves fully engaged with the space, physically and cerebrally, so that they may ponder the questions posed by the artist, such as how we use our senses; whether our actions have consequences; whether we feel a part of this world; and whether the sky is indeed part of our landscape.
Olafur Eliasson, born in 1967, Copenhagen, Denmark, is currently based in Berlin, where he has established Studio Olafur Eliasson, a laboratory for spatial experiments. His works have been the subject of numerous exhibitions worldwide and he has produced a number of projects in the public sphere, most recently the "New York City Waterfalls" in 2008. Recently, the San Francisco Museum of Modern Art organized his first comprehensive survey in the U.S., "Take your time: Olafur Eliasson," which along others travelled to the Museum of Modern Art, P.S.1. Contemporary Art Center, New York and continues to MCA Sydney in December. This winter he will have another solo show "Your chance encounter" at the 21st Century Museum of Contemporary Art, Kanazawa.
